Constraints - Siemens SINUMERIK 840D sl Function Manual

Hide thumbs Also See for SINUMERIK 840D sl:
Table of Contents

Advertisement

M1: Kinematic transformation
7.8 Activating transformation machine data via parts program/softkey
7.8.2

Constraints

Change machine data
The machine data which affect an active transformation may not be altered; any attempt to
do so will generate an alarm.
These are generally all machine data assigned to a transformation via the associated
transformation data group. Machine data that are included in the group of an active
transformation, but not in use, can be altered (although this would hardly be meaningful). For
example, it would be possible to change machine data MD24564
$MC_TRAFO5_NUTATOR_AX_ANGLE_n for an active transformation with MD24100
$MC_$MC_TRAFO_TYPE = 16 (5-axis transformation with rotatable tool and two mutually
perpendicular rotary axes A and B) since this particular machine data is not involved in the
transformation.
Please note that machine data MD21110 $MC_X_AXIS_IN_OLD_X_Z_PLANE may not be
altered for an active orientation transformation.
Note
In the case of a program interruption (Repos, deletion of distance to go, ASUBs, etc.), the
control system requires a number of different blocks that have already been executed for the
repositioning operation. The rule forbidding the machine data of an active transformation to
be altered also refers to these blocks.
Example:
Two orientation transformations are set via machine data, e.g. MD24100
$MC_TRAFO_TYPE_1 = 16, MD24200 $MC_TRAFO_TYPE_2 = 18.
Assume that the second transformation is active when the NEWCONFIG command is
executed. In this case, all machine data that relate only to the first transformation may be
changed, e.g.:
MD24500 $MC_TRAFO5_PART_OFFSET_1
but not, for instance:
MD24650 $MC_TRAFO5_BASE_TOOL_2
or
MD21110 $MC_X_AXIS_IN_OLD_X_Z_PLANE
Furthermore, another transformation (TRANSMIT) can be set, for example with MD24300
$MC_TRAFO_TYPE_3 = 256 and can be parameterized with additional machine data.
Defining geometry axes
Geometry axes must be defined before starting the control system with the following
machine data:
MD24120 $MC_TRAFO_GEOAX_ASSIGN_TAB_X[n]
or
MD20050 $MC_AXCONF_GEOAX_ASSIGN_TAB[n]
578
Function Manual, 09/2009, 6FC5397-1BP20-0BA0
Extended Functions

Hide quick links:

Advertisement

Table of Contents
loading

This manual is also suitable for:

Sinumerik 840de slSinumerik 828d

Table of Contents